晶粒取向镍—铁合金各向异性的磁转矩法研究
引用本文:何开元,吴宝琴.晶粒取向镍—铁合金各向异性的磁转矩法研究[J].物理学报,1963,19(11):717-726.
作者姓名:何开元  吴宝琴
作者单位:钢铁研究院
摘    要:本文测定了冷轧的及冷轧后又经不同温度退火的50%Ni-50%Fe合金的磁转矩曲线,从而对试样中的冷轧及再结晶结构作了推断。从具有完整立方结构的试样上测得的磁晶各向异性常数k1和其他作者从单晶体上得到的值相近,而从保有冷轧结构的试样定得的k1值则较大。考察了影响k1测定值的可能因素;讨论了磁致伸缩各向异性导致的弹性能以及有序程度对k1值的影响。 关键词

MAGNETIC TORQUE STUDIES OF THE ANISOTROPY OF A GRAIN ORIENTED NICKEL-IRON ALLOY
HO KAI-YUAN and WU PAO-CHING.MAGNETIC TORQUE STUDIES OF THE ANISOTROPY OF A GRAIN ORIENTED NICKEL-IRON ALLOY[J].Acta Physica Sinica,1963,19(11):717-726.
Authors:HO KAI-YUAN and WU PAO-CHING
Abstract:The magnetic anisotropy of a 50% Ni-50% Fe alloy, after (1) cold reduction and (2) cold reduction and annealing at various temperatures, has been determined from magnetic torque curves, from which the types of the rolling and recrystallization textures in the specimens have been deduced. In the specimens with perfect cube texture, the magnetic anisotropy constant k1 has been determined; the result is consistent with that of other authors' using single crystal specimens. The k1 value in the cold rolled specimens is, however, larger. The factors which may possibly influence the determined k1 values are considered; the influences due to the degree of ordering and the elastic energy induced by anisotropic magnetostriction are finally discussed.
